“itemizing” — questions & answers

How do you pronounce “itemizing”?

“itemizing” is pronounced AI-ta-MAI-zing — IPA /ˈaɪtəˌmaɪzɪŋ/. In Ingglish phonetic spelling, where every spelling always makes the same sound, it is written “aitamaizing”.

How many syllables are in “itemizing”?

“itemizing” has 4 syllables: AI-ta-MAI-zing (the capitalized syllable is stressed).
